Comparison review

Motorola Edge 50 Ultra has a global score of 87.1, which is much better than Galaxy A56 5G (Rumored)'s overall score of 78.7. Both phones we compare here work with the same Android 14 OS (Operating System), so both should provide you all the same operating system features. The Motorola Edge 50 Ultra features a much better looking screen than Samsung Galaxy A56 5G (Rumored), because although it has a just a little lower screen density, and they both have the same exact resolution of 1080 x 2400, the Motorola Edge 50 Ultra also counts with a little bit bigger display.

The Motorola Edge 50 Ultra and Samsung Galaxy A56 5G (Rumored) count with very similar processors, and although the Motorola Edge 50 Ultra has a greater amount of RAM memory, they both have 8 CPU cores. Motorola Edge 50 Ultra takes clearer photos and videos than Galaxy A56 5G (Rumored), and although they both have the same resolution camera and the same 3840x2160 video quality, the Motorola Edge 50 Ultra also has a larger sensor taking more light and vivid colors, faster video frame rates and a bigger aperture to take better low-light photography and videos.

The Motorola Edge 50 Ultra has a superior memory for applications and games than Galaxy A56 5G (Rumored), because it has 512 GB internal memory. Samsung Galaxy A56 5G (Rumored) counts with a little better battery lifetime than Motorola Edge 50 Ultra, because it has 5000mAh of battery capacity against 4500mAh.
